Shuffle Command
From GeoGebra Manual
- Shuffle( <List> )
- Returns list with same elements, but in random order.
- Note: You can recompute the list via Recompute all objects in View Menu (or pressing F9).

CAS Syntax
- Shuffle( <List> )
- Returns list with same elements, but in random order.
- Examples:
Shuffle({3, 5, 1, 7, 3})
yields for example {5, 1, 3, 3, 7}.Shuffle(Sequence(20))
gives the first 20 whole numbers in a random order.
